EE Move Database Error

May 05, 2013 6:31pm

Subscribe [1]
  • #1 / May 05, 2013 6:31pm

    thefifthlion

    133 posts

    Moved an EE site for a client over to their new hosting provider.

    I followed the steps at the following url:
    http://ellislab.com/expressionengine/user-guide/operations/moving.html

    ————————-

    I get the following error:

    A Database Error Occurred

    Unable to connect to your database server using the provided settings.

    Filename: D:\Hosting\10994054\html\system\codeigniter\system\database\DB_driver.php

    Line Number: 124

    ————————-

    Any ideas on what the culprit could be?

  • #2 / May 05, 2013 6:41pm

    thefifthlion

    133 posts

    godaddy doesn’t like “localhost” and once I switched to their provided hostname it worked, but now the paths to stylesheets etc. are off. In the step 10 it says I can update the paths in the config.php, where can I locate that file?
